High school football 2022: Derrick Bobo ready to tackle high expectations at Melrose
Melrose High School head football coach Derrick Bobo demonstrates running upfield past defenders during practice at Melrose High School football field, Monday, July 18, 2022.(Greg Campbell/Special for The Daily Memphian)
The former star defensive back at Whitehaven will lead his team onto the field for the first time on Aug. 20 when the Golden Wildcats open the 2022 season at home against White Station.
